I made my own from a scrap of 52100, works perfectly and was pretty quick to make.
It is a simple shape and I can give you the dimensions if needed.
I actually use a round bending nose more often as it rolls with the material and doesn't mark the 3/8 or 1/2 round bar that I mostly bend.

Here are some photos with dimensions.
Of course the centre hole is 1" in diameter.
I made the nose taller than normal but 1.5" would be the stock size.

Not all the dimensions are critical, the back pointy section is but the front is not given that the nose clamp is adjustable.
The point fits into the notch in the dowel and allows the forming nose to swing out of the way on the return after bending.
Mostly I use a round forming nose that rolls with the bend and I find that very useful for bending 1/2" solid round bar.
